Adafruit 16-Channel 12-bit PWMServo Shield - I2C interface
Product Buying Guide
The Adafruit 16-Channel 12-bit PWMServo Shield with I2C interface is a versatile and efficient PWM driver that is suitable for controlling servos and LEDs. With its adjustable frequency PWM and 12-bit resolution for each output, it offers precise control and great flexibility. The shield's I2C interface and the ability to stack multiple shields make it a convenient and expandable solution for various projects and applications.
Key Features
- I2C-controlled PWM driver with a built-in clock, allowing for free-running operation without tying up the microcontroller
- 5V compliant, enabling safe drive up to 6V outputs from a 3.3V Arduino
- 6 address select pins for stacking up to 62 shields on a single I2C bus, resulting in a total of 992 outputs
- Adjustable frequency PWM up to about 1.6 KHz with 12-bit resolution for each output

Customer Questions & Answers
-
Question:
What is the maximum number of PWM outputs that can be controlled?
Answer: Up to 992 PWM outputs can be controlled by stacking up to 62 of these on a single i2c bus. -
Question:
Can it be controlled from a 3.3V Arduino?
Answer: Yes, it is 5V compliant, allowing control from a 3.3V Arduino and still safely driving up to 6V outputs. -
Question:
What is the resolution for each output?
Answer: Each output has a 12-bit resolution, providing about 4us resolution at a 60Hz update rate.
